Sonofabitch, if only other “new metal” bands sounded like this. Slipknot is a nine-headed, bondage-loving, death metal backboned machine of destruction. Hailing from Iowa, of all places, the self-titled debut album from these masked freaks is not only the heaviest record this year (along with Integrity 2000), but one of the scariest as well. “You can’t see California without Marlon Brando’s eyes?” You can’t help but wonder what fucked up thoughts fester in those hooded skulls. With tracks like “Eyeless” and “(Sic)” being so intensely brutal, I can’t even imagine what kind of damage they’d do in a live situation.
